    "content": "I urge the Ministry of Livestock Development to think about market access by our people. Up to now we do not have any formal market for the livestock in this nation. We take our livestock to Kariobangi and Dandora in a very informal setting that is controlled by brokers. This cannot make our people have a good living out of this sector which is their lifeline. I urge the Ministry to think seriously about market access. It boggles my mind that Ethiopians are able to export their animals to Yemen and Saudi Arabia. This is the case and yet our animals cross the porous borders of northern Kenya and are bought by Ethiopians who sell them in Yemen. In Kenya, we are said to be within a disease zone and as such we are unable to access those markets. Something is fundamentally wrong in terms of policy. I hope that the Ministry will see to it that we access the lucrative markets in the Middle East."
